Biography:

Early on, The Master of Puppets was nothing but a fairly low level Balanced wrestler. It took him until he was Level 7 to join a federation. However, previous to this, he formed a fairly successful Tag Team with Master of Puppets, before he went inactive. Thus, M.O.P. was to look for Federations alone. JR Bonecrusher, GM of the now defunct BTWE offered him a mid-carder contract, which The Master of Puppets graciously accepted. In fact, it is JR who gave him the "M.O.P." nickname. He spent several months in "the new BTWE" as a relatively unknown wrestler, never getting higher than #3 contender for the United States Championship. Eventually, due to personal issues, GM JR closed BTWE, leaving The Master of Puppets out of work. However, after BTWE ended operations, but before it officially closed, The Master of Puppets became a much better wrestler, becoming Level Champion many times and defeating quite good wrestlers.

Eventually, a contract was offered by NICW General Manager, Stone Cold Gary Barnes. After a quick negotiation, the contract was signed. Now he was a fairly well known wrestler, with a higher score and higher level. He became better known that he ever was in BTWE. In his first couple of season, The Master of Puppets formed a Tag Team with Matt Stone, called The Master and Matt, and they feuded for the new NICW Tag Team titles, and they became the first champions. During their partnership, M.O.P. was offered a VGM spot by SCGB. He then became even more well known. Soon, their team ended, and they even feuded for a season after The Master of Puppets became European Champion. Then he began a feud with Jammin George over the belt. They fought through a season, and now their feud has been taken to the next level. Now, they each have a stable. M.O.P.'s was The Warriors, with Rex Hitman, Shadow Callahan and Matt Stone, and eventually Sparkhawk. The Stable storyline ended to the criticism of many, assuming it had ended too early, due a lot to backstage issues between wrestlers.

The Master of Puppets spent several more seasons in NICW. Following his reign as European Champion, he became the Ulster Heavyweight Champion. However, tensions were beginning to rise backstage. He, along with several other men, left the federation to pursue other opportunities. Mank and M.O.P. ended up in RCW, with an old friend by the name of Ursu'. Not much time was spent there however, until RCW folded. But soon, a great opportunity was on the horizon.

Sparkhawk, an old friend of the Master, announced one day to him that he was now a GM, and The Master of Puppets was soon a member of Wrestling International Industry. Once again a Vice-General Manager, the Master of Puppets is planning on a long career in WII. After a few successful seasons, The Master of Puppets won the WII International Title, his first in WII. After dropping the belt to Jumpstyle, he regained the belt after one show, and then three times defended the belt in extreme matches against DaWolf.
